Crime Talk
The following words and expressions will be important for understanding and talking
about this story. Look for a list of Crime Talk words at the beginning of each chapter (for
example, page 9). Those are the Crime Talk words that will appear in that chapter.

accuse say that someone did a crime


alibi proof that you were elsewhere at the time of a crime and so could not do the crime
attorney a lawyer
behind bars in jail
case a police investigation
clue an item or piece of information that helps solve a case
fingerprints marks left by fingers; (everybody has different fingerprints)
frame use false evidence to make an innocent person seem guilty of a crime
motive a reason to commit a crime
proof or evidence* facts or objects that show who probably did a crime
robbery a theft; the stealing of something using force
under arrest taken by the police; charged with a crime
victim a person who is hurt or killed in a crime or accident
* Note: Proof and evidence are uncountable nouns.
You can say:

Does he have some proof? or She found three pieces of evidence.
But you cannot say:

She has three proofs. or He found many evidences.

Crime Talk
The following words and expressions will be important for understanding and talking
about this story. Look for a list of Crime Talk words at the beginning of each chapter (for
example, page 77). Those are the Crime Talk words that will appear in that chapter.

badge a card or metal piece that identifies your job


blackmail asking for money to keep a secret
CIA Central Intelligence Agency, the organization in the United States government
that seeks secret information about other countries
confess say that you did a crime
coroner a doctor who examines people who have died
dirty cop a police officer who breaks the law
handcuffs metal rings connected by a chain that can be locked; police use these to stop
people from moving their hands freely
holding cell a jail where suspects are kept after they are arrested
line of questioning a series of connected questions about a topic
murderer a person who kills another person not by mistake
outline the shape of a victims body made with tape or chalk
suspicion a doubt about a person or case
suspicious seeming strange or false
warrant a piece of paper, signed by a judge, that allows the police to enter and search
a building
weapon an object used to hurt another person

About the Authors

Adam Gray

Adam Gray is currently a bilingual (English/Spanish) elementary school teacher in Lewisville, Texas,
but has taught all levels of students, from kindergarten to university, in Japan, Chile, and the United
States. He holds a Bachelors degree in English from the Ohio State University, where his academic
focus was on creative writing. In addition, Adam holds a Masters degree in TESOL from American
University in Washington DC, where he also served as an adjunct professor. Adam is thrilled to have
combined his two passions, fiction writing and English language education, for this project. He
currently lives near Dallas, Texas with his wife Katty and his daughter, Iliana.

Marcos Benevides

Marcos Benevides has taught English as a foreign language in Japan at every level from elementary
to graduate school. He holds a Masters in Education from the University of Calgary, and an Honours
B.A. with a double major in literature and creative writing from Concordia University in Montreal.
His other English language teaching titles include the critically acclaimed and innovative Widgets: A
task-based course in practical English (Pearson Longman), which was co-written with Chris Valvona.
Marcos currently lives near Osaka with his wife Yoko and his young children, Kei and Maya.
